Transaction 70c175357d757c391bd37787669ba2d2ce70aeb485d9af3051a0af1e6c26ac2f
1 Input
1 Output
-
70c175357d757c391bd37787669ba2d2ce70aeb485d9af3051a0af1e6c26ac2f:0
- value
- 107500
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ec1edbadc34140e6ae7585f06ec8d5d354a17aa7 OP_EQUAL
- address
- 3PDWMsjU3Do2BjkLy1WxSPvPF4rZBJS2gs